Android studio不显示字符串预览

时间:2013-05-16 16:41:58

标签: android android-studio

我在Mac OS X上运行Android Studio,我无法在编辑器中看到硬编码的字符串值,也看不到drawables预览。无论如何,我可以在xml文件中看到颜色预览。我需要打开任何选项吗?

我知道这可能是由于一个错误,但是他们已经强烈宣传了这个功能,所以恕我直言它有效!

3 个答案:

答案 0 :(得分:45)

必须在设置>下检查“Android字符串引用”选项编辑>代码折叠,但默认情况下会进行检查。对我来说,它似乎不会自动进行字符串预览。我必须右键单击某些代码中的任何位置,例如getString(R.string.mystring),然后转到折叠>坍方。或者,您也可以按Ctrl +' - '折叠它。这可能是预期的行为或错误。似乎他们暗示它在主题演讲中是自动的,但也许不是。

就drawables预览而言,我认为它仅适用于只有一个资源实例的drawable。因此,如果您在多个可绘制文件夹中有一个icon.png(例如drawable-mdpi和drawable-hdpi),那么您将无法获得预览。至少,这就是它对我有用的方式。当我尝试使用只有一个可绘制文件夹的图标时,我只看到了预览。

答案 1 :(得分:21)

光标打开时,按 Ctrl + Period (或Mac OS X上的 + Period getString或预览字,然后切换字符串。

答案 2 :(得分:1)

现在你应该使用键盘快捷键Command +' - '或命令+'。'在android studio中显示字符串预览。